To create end nodes you can either use the Chopper or - a better
solution I think - grab the coords with the CoordinateFetcher and
write them with the 2DPointReplacer.

> I think the problem is that the TopologyBuilder is smarter than i need
> it to be. My line network is already "clean" in that the lines connect
> and their endpoints are the only things I want to calculate upon. 
> 
> I'm not certain, but it *looks* like I can use the
> SpatialRelationshipFactory to build the topology. If I can create
> seperate node features for each line endpoint, I can pass the nodes
> and lines through seperate counters to provide unique ids and then use
> the node as the base and the line as the candidate for the
> SpatialRelator. 
> 
> Is there a factory that will generate nodes from the endpoints of lines?
> 
> But, it might take two passes through the SpatialRelator, because the
> nodes must know what lines they touch and the lines must know what
> nodes they touch.

> > > > Hi Thom,
> > > > I think you can do what you want quite easily.
> > > > 
> > > > Run all of your line features through a Counter to give them a
> unique
> > > > ID (unless they have one already).
> > > > 
> > > > Then set the TopologyBuilder group-by to use the unique ID.
> > > > 
> > > > Doing this will exclude overlapping lines from the node
generation;
> > > > overlaps would only get noded where their IDs are the same.
However,
> > > > nodes are still created where end-points meet.
